Ingredients

The primary ingredient in Bardinet XO French Brandy is grapes. These grapes are carefully selected from vineyards in France. The choice of grape variety plays a crucial role in the final taste of the brandy. Water and yeast are also essential components in the fermentation process.

Preparation

The preparation of Bardinet XO involves several steps. First, the grapes are fermented to produce wine. This wine is then distilled to create a clear spirit. The spirit is aged in oak barrels for several years, allowing it to develop its rich flavour and aroma.

Flavour Profile

Bardinet XO French Brandy offers a complex flavour profile. It features notes of dried fruits, vanilla, and spices. The aging process in oak barrels adds depth and character to the brandy, resulting in a smooth and refined taste.

Pairings

Bardinet XO pairs well with various foods. It complements rich desserts like chocolate cake or crème brûlée. Cheese platters featuring blue cheese or aged cheddar also enhance the brandy's flavours.

Serving Suggestions

To enjoy Bardinet XO at its best, serve it neat or on the rocks. A snifter glass is ideal for appreciating its aroma. For a refreshing twist, try it in cocktails like a Sidecar or Brandy Sour.

Distillation and Aging Process

The distillation process involves heating fermented wine to separate alcohol from water. The resulting spirit is then aged in oak barrels for several years, allowing it to develop complexity and depth.

Cocktail Recipes

Cocktail NameIngredientsInstructions
SidecarBardinet XO, Cointreau, Lemon JuiceShake ingredients with ice; strain into glass; garnish with lemon twist.
Brandy SourBardinet XO, Lemon Juice, Sugar SyrupMix ingredients; serve over ice; garnish with cherry or lemon slice.
